Professional tourist guides in Iceland guided for free 85 foreign tourists around the city center of Reykjavik on International Tourist Guide Day, 21 February 2009.

The initiative was very well received at visitor centers, hotels and guesthouses where the event was promoted, and of course the guest who enoyed a free guided walk accompanied by a professional tourist guide.
Nearly half of the guests who enjoyed the free service of professional guides arrived for the first departure at eleven o'clock in the morning. Departures thereafter took place every half hour until three o'clock.

The guests were guided in English, German, French and Scandinavian languages. The walk started at Hallgrimskirkja Memorial Church in Reykjavik and included the old city center.

The shortest walk of the day lasted 40 minutes and the longest 2 hours as the duration of the trip depended on the demands and wishes of the guests.

The weather played a role during the day. The Iceland Meteorological Office issued a storm warning for the afternoon which materialised, bringing heavy rain. The poor weather probably caused some people to refrain from taking a guided walk in the city. The tourist guides on the other hand were prepared for rain or shine and did not mind the weather.
